About the Role

The Maintenance Planner Facilities is responsible for the planning, scheduling, safe and compliant execution of all site service, maintenance and compliance activities required at our MILVEHCOE facility & other national sites.

This is a critical role in the facilities team as you lead the site maintenance planning function including all mechanical, electrical and general activities on-site. From assessing any problems and upgrades to proactive maintenance, we aim to have all equipment up to its highest standard. With our ever-growing manufacturing plant, we have a continuous focus on the safe function of all items on-site. With the use of our CMMS system, we make sure we keep track of compliance and any relevant statutory and regulatory requirements.

The experience and skillset best suited to this role includes:

  • Tertiary qualifications in Maintenance / Engineering (Mechanical, Electrical) or relevant discipline;
  • Experience in a maintenance planner position on a large industrial manufacturing site;
  • Significant CMMS experience;
  • Significant Safe Access and isolation experience;
  • Contractor Management and permit to work experience;
  • Excellent understanding of Australian Standards – AS1851 / AS2550 / AS4024;
  • Ability to travel internationally and interstate, when required; and
  • Eligibility to obtain an Australian Government Security Clearance (Australian Citizenship required).
